What is the first step to treating frostbite?

Explanation:
The first step to treating frostbite involves assessing the situation and observing signs of frostbite. This is crucial because recognizing the symptoms—such as pale, numb skin, or blisters—helps determine the severity of the injury and guides the subsequent steps in treatment. Observing the affected area allows the first aider to understand whether the frostbite is superficial or deep, which can influence whether immediate medical care is necessary. Taking the time to accurately assess the condition ensures that the person receives the appropriate care and avoids further injury, which is vital in frostbite cases. Once the signs are recognized, appropriate actions can follow, such as gradually rewarming the affected area or seeking medical assistance if needed.
